  Course Description:  
   
 
Helping students understand the fundamental concepts necessary for analyzing and improving manufacturing and service operations is the primary objective of the course. Topics covered include forecasting process analysis, project management, inventory management, linear programming, and supply chain management. Prerequisites: ACCT 2311, STAT 2301/2331, ECO 1311 and 1312, and Calculus.
